The PVC is not meant to be structural...it's just there to prevent water entering the hull while still having a hole through both sides. You then put a loop of spectra or vectran through the hole...outerside goes through a good sized stainless washer and then gets decent sized stopper knot. The inner end of the loop serves as a tie off point for the pole end stays.

My boat has a medium sized eye-bolt completly through each bow tip, embedded with highdensity filled epoxy and a washer/nut on the outer side. Not pretty, but it has lasted 5 + years of heavy loading.
